>     So, from the chart, there is gearing for 65wpm - 390 opm, 45.5 baud,
>     7.00 unit code. There is a motor pinion and the driven gear.
> 
>     Keyboard (LAK)  gearset 173795   consisting of:
> 
>     Gears:     173794 14 tooth
> 
>                        173793 100 tooth
> 
>     Isolator   159287
> 
>     Posts       161301  (need 2)
> 
> 
>     Gearing for 60wpm - 368 opm, 45.5 baud. 7.42 unit code
> 
>     Keyboard (LAK) gearset 161293  consisting of:
> 
>     Gears:     159278  14 tooth
> 
>                        159279  96 tooth
> 
>     Isolator  159287 (same)
> 
>     Posts      161301 (same)
